    This Drop Fiber is constructed with Single Mode fiber (9/125 µm) and comes in core counts of 2, 4, 8, 12, 24, 48 strands. Single Mode fiber in this drop cable has the ability to operate at 1G/10G/40G/100G/400G speeds. With the cladding layer, they are 125 micron, and with the buffer layer they are 250 micron. To prevent excessive loss. Drop Fiber Cable is an out door rated fiber cable. Drop cable is ideally used in shorter distance connections (under 4km), primarily due to the construction of the cable.     All-dielectric self-supporting (ADSS) cable is a type of that is strong enough to support itself between structures without using conductive metal elements. It is used by companies as a communications medium, installed along existing overhead transmission lines and often sharing the same support structures as the electrical conductors.     Several different designs are used to create birefringence in a fiber. The fiber may be geometrically asymmetric or have a refractive index profile which is asymmetric such as the design using an elliptical as shown in the diagram.
